Novel nucleoside analogue FNC is effective against both wild-type and lamivudine-resistant HBV clinical isolates.
Antiviral therapy - 1 Jan 2012
Zhou Yubing, Zhang Yan, Yang Xiaoang, Zhao Jing, Zheng Liyun, Sun Changyu, Jiang Jinhua, Yang Qinghua, Wang Qingduan, Chang Junbiao
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ND: HBV infection causes major public health problems worldwide. The clinical limitation of current antiviral drugs for HBV, such as lamivudine, is causing rapid emergence of drug-resistant viral strains during prolonged antiviral therapy. Therefore, new antiviral drugs are urgently needed to prevent or delay the selection of drug-resistant HBV mutants. A novel cytidine analogue, FNC...
